General Information about #1A1D44
The hex color code #1A1D44, also known as Bunting, is a dark shade of blue-violet. It is composed of 10.2% red, 11.4% green, and 26.7% blue. In the RGB color model, this represents relatively low values for red and green, and a higher value for blue, which accounts for its bluish appearance. The color is often associated with feelings of calmness, sophistication, and depth. It's a popular choice in designs aiming to convey professionalism or a sense of reliability. The hexadecimal system is a base-16 numeral system, widely used in computing and digital electronics to represent colors. Each hexadecimal digit represents four bits, and two digits specify the intensity of each primary color (red, green, and blue).
The hex color #1a1d44, also known as Bunting, presents several accessibility considerations, especially in web design. Its dark hue implies that it requires light-colored text for sufficient contrast. According to WCAG guidelines, the contrast ratio between text and background should be at least 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text to meet AA compliance. Using a color like white (#ffffff) or a very light gray would be suitable. If this color is used for interactive elements, such as buttons or links, ensure that hover, focus, and active states have clear visual indicators to aid users with visual impairments or those relying on keyboard navigation. Providing sufficient contrast and clear visual cues ensures inclusivity and a better user experience for everyone.

Applications
Web Design
In web design, #1a1d44 can serve as a sophisticated background for websites, particularly those in the finance or technology sectors, where a sense of stability and professionalism is desired. It pairs well with lighter text colors like white or light yellow for readability. Furthermore, it can be used in website headers, footers, and sidebars to create a visually appealing and structured layout. Incorporating it in charts or graphs can also help distinguish data series effectively.
